Start with analytics firms if you aren't from a tier 1 college.
I did too after undergrad. Many of my former colleagues from this company, switched to top tier consulting firms to data science/analytics roles and have now moved up the ranks. This will take a long time though. You'll get really good exposure plus travel depending on your role and the company.
